ORDU. The decision of Turkey's central bak to raise the interest rate by 4.75% has given the lira a nominal lift. Export prices have, however, taken a rather surprising turn. Market players are now waiting for Ferrero.

Export prices decline, despite lira gaining in value

The lira gained some momentum with the key interest rate now ranging at 15 percentage points. Analysts had, however, reckoned that the hike in the interest rate would have a stronger impact. Ferrero's withdawal from the inshell market, nevertheless, prompted a decline in export prices at the end of last week. Exporters are taking advantage of this trend to refill stocks at low prices, which they can then sell to Ferrero at higher prices.
